About the Role As a Patient Access Representative at Quincy Medical Group, you will help create a positive first impression for our patients while ensuring they have a smooth experience accessing care. Whether assisting patients at check-in, scheduling appointments, verifying insurance, or answering questions, you will play an important role in supporting both patients and care teams. This position is a great opportunity for someone who enjoys helping others, thrives in a fast-paced environment, and is looking to build a career in healthcare. Schedule Full-time position based at one of Quincy Medical Group's Quincy, Illinois locations. Schedules vary by department and may include different start and end times. Specific schedules and department placement will be discussed during the interview process to help determine the best fit. No overnight shifts. Fast-paced healthcare environment focused on exceptional patient service and access to care. Primary Responsibilities Greet patients and visitors in a professional, welcoming, and compassionate manner. Register patients and accurately collect demographic, insurance, and financial information. Schedule appointments and assist patients with appointment changes and follow-up visits. Verify insurance eligibility and obtain required authorizations as appropriate. Collect co-payments and process patient payments according to organizational policies. Answer incoming phone calls and assist patients with scheduling, registration, and general inquiries. Maintain accurate patient records within the electronic medical record system. Coordinate communication between patients, providers, and care teams to support efficient clinic operations. Provide excellent customer service while managing multiple tasks and priorities. Perform other duties as assigned to support clinic operations. Qualifications High school diploma or GED required. Previous customer service, administrative, retail, hospitality, banking, healthcare, or office experience preferred. Strong communication and interpersonal skills. Ability to multitask and remain organized in a fast-paced environment. Basic computer and data entry skills required. Ability to maintain professionalism and confidentiality when handling patient information. Experience with healthcare registration, scheduling, or electronic medical records is helpful but not required. Commitment to providing exceptional service and creating a positive patient experience. Benefits Comprehensive medical, dental, and vision benefits that include healthcare navigation assistance. Access to a mental health benefit at no cost. Employer provided life and disability insurance. $5,250 Tuition Reimbursement per year. Immediate 401(k) match. 40 hours paid volunteer time off. A culture committed to community engagement and social impact. Up to 12 weeks parental leave at 100% pay and a financial benefit for adoption and surrogacy for non-physician team members once eligibility requirements are met. The compensation for this role includes a base pay range of $15.35 - $23.03 per hour , with actual pay determined by factors such as skills, experience, education, geographic location, and internal equity. Additional compensation may be available through shift differentials, bonuses, and other incentives. Base pay is only a portion of the total rewards package.
